Cubepack Group is a diversified import-export company based in Sri Lanka, positioning itself as a “global import-export partner.” Judging from the website, it is not an e-commerce platform or SaaS tool in the traditional sense. Instead, it serves as a B2B procurement, import, customs clearance, logistics, and local delivery service provider for Sri Lankan businesses, while also exporting Ceylon spices through Zaha Ceylon.
Its product coverage is fairly broad, including paper and packaging materials, tapioca/corn/adhesive starches, industrial chemicals, Ceylon spices, hardware tools, construction materials, and vehicle imports. The platform emphasizes working directly with trusted global manufacturers to secure more consistent quality and more competitive pricing. In terms of fulfillment, Cubepack claims it can manage the full import lifecycle—from product sourcing, supplier verification, shipping, cargo consolidation, and customs clearance to local delivery within Sri Lanka. It also supports special product sourcing and sample arrangements for selected categories.
The website does not publicly disclose commission rates, service fees, minimum order quantities, payment terms, or payment methods. Its pricing model appears to be closer to project-based quotation. Its main pricing proposition is “Direct Imports, Better Pricing,” meaning it aims to reduce intermediary costs through direct manufacturer sourcing. The vehicle import section mentions transparent pricing, but does not provide detailed figures.
Its strength lies in a relatively complete service chain, making it suitable for local businesses that lack experience in international procurement and customs clearance. It covers essential categories such as packaging, industrial raw materials, and hardware, and can source customized products based on industry-specific technical requirements. The downside is that the website is more brochure-like than operationally transparent: it lacks customer case studies, certification documents, fulfillment timelines, inventory status, online ordering, order tracking, and other key information. For cross-border e-commerce sellers, it is more of a supply chain and trade services provider than a platform for direct product listing or automated fulfillment.
It is better suited to Sri Lankan manufacturers, packaging factories, paper product companies, industrial goods traders, construction and hardware buyers, vehicle import customers, as well as brands or traders looking to export Ceylon spices. It is less suitable for e-commerce sellers looking for standardized online product selection, store listing tools, overseas warehouse delivery, or marketplace distribution solutions.
